Thanks for stopping by the Columbus Lesbian and Gay Softball Association (CLGSA) website. CLGSA is one of the largest gay softball associations in the Midwest. It is a 501c(3) organization founded in 1986, focused on providing opportunity and access for the LGBTQIA community and their allies to participate in organized softball competitions. CLGSA is an open-division softball league open to LGBTQIA+ players and friends in the Columbus metropolitan area. The organization strengthens our community by providing social connections, camaraderie, and athletic competition for players at all skill levels. CLGSA is an iPride Member City. As we wrap up the 2025 Spring/Summer season, we are proud to announce the opening of the 2025 Fall Ball registration! The season will begin on September 7th and run through October 12th. This year we will have a max of 15 players per a team. Registration will close on August 22nd and we will be hosting a Jersey Night the weekend before the season starts. Fall ball is a great time to meet players in the league and have fun working on improving your skills. It is a draft style season, so no need to find a team!
